Special committe of the European Parliament on tax dumping will come to Ireland

The special committee of the European Parliament against tax dumping has already held several hearings and has undertaken first delegation visits. The aim of the delegation visits are selected countries that are known for enabling tax dumping.

After visits to Belgium, Luxembourg and Switzerland a delegation will travel to Ireland on 28 May 2015. There, we will meet the Irish finance minister, members of the Irish parliament and representatives of several stakeholders.
